In the Edmond and broader West Virginia area, a complete walk-in tub purchase and professional installation typically ranges from $5,000 to $15,000+, depending on the tub's features and the complexity of your bathroom layout. Many reputable local providers partner with national financing companies to offer payment plans. Additionally, West Virginia residents should explore potential assistance through the state's Medicaid waiver programs or VA benefits if they qualify, as these can sometimes help offset costs for medically necessary installations.
Edmond's seasonal weather and rural location are key planning factors. Winter installations can be delayed by snow and icy roads, especially for crews traveling from larger metro areas, making spring through fall the ideal time to schedule. Furthermore, being in a more rural part of Braxton County, it's wise to plan for potential longer lead times for delivery of the tub unit itself and to confirm your chosen local installer services your specific area to avoid extra travel fees.
While Edmond itself may not have a municipal building department, Braxton County or the State of West Virginia may have applicable plumbing and electrical codes. A reputable, licensed local installer will handle securing any necessary permits from the county for the plumbing and electrical work, which is crucial for ensuring the installation is safe, up to code, and won't cause issues with your home insurance. Walk-in tubs hold more water than standard tubs, so your septic system's capacity should be evaluated to ensure it can handle the additional drainage load. For homes on well water, the larger fill volume may require checking your well pump's recovery rate and pressure tank to ensure it can adequately fill the tub in a reasonable time without draining other household water pressure.
